The summer of 2025 was my first visit and I have been back several additional times with family and friend groups. I attended one of the YergeyFest nights and that was quite the party!
I was pleased to see they make efforts to connect with the community and integrate other local businesses by hosting various special events.
The food trucks they feature are a bonus!
Friend of the Devil was my favorite brew.
I look forward to spending more time as a patron with my retirement quickly approaching, allowing me more discretionary time for pursuits such as this!
As an Emmaus resident, I’m happy we have a high standards “gathering place” option nearby.
Great job Yergey Brewing team! See you again soon!

We stopped in today for YergFest 2025. I didn't mention the same (uncommon) last name, but the bartender noticed it when I ran my credit card. We got the Hoptileitious (Double IPA) and the Salty German (a Gose). Both beers were delicious. Jim came out to visit with us after hearing of the same last name. We had a really nice conversation with him, and ordered a second round before leaving.
Our bartender, Bekah, had a long line for the event, but was very efficient and handled several customers in a short amount of time. We'll definitely go back when we travel to the area.
